OUR CORE VALUE

 

  • WORSHIP IS A PRIORITY:  We live to worship God joyfully and gratefully for Who He is and for all that He has done. (John 4:23-24)

 

  • GOD’S WORD is the final authority for life:  We seek to grow through the consistent application of scripture to our lives, our attitudes, and our relationships. (1 Peter 2:2)

 

  • SPIRIT-FILLED WITNESS to our world:  We seek to proclaim the Gospel of Jesus Christ through personal witness, evangelistic endeavors as a church and through church-planting both at home and abroad. (Matthew 28:18-20)

 

  • FELLOWSHIP:  As an interdependent people, we understand the value of meeting together as a corporate body and in smaller groups to bear one another burdens. (Hebrew 10:24-25)

 

  • GIVING AND STEWARDSHIP:  We recognize that all our material possessions are a gift from God given to further His work and glory in the world.  We value giving money to further the ministries of the church through our tithes and offerings. (2 Corinthians 8:7)

 

  • COMMITMENT TO SERVICE:  The Holy Spirit gives each of us abilities to serve one another, the church at large and the community in which we live.  Discovering and developing those gifts to serve others is our constant aim. (Galatians 5:13-14)

OUR ROOTS

 

The Potter's House of Chesapeake is a Christian Fellowship Ministries' Church (CFM).  CFM, Inc. was founded in 1970 by Pastor Wayman Mitchell. A spiritual fire was launched that is spanning the globe.  Now, over 3,200 churches have been planted in over 130 nations of the world with the number growing daily.  From that, crusades and conferences sprung up that are touching tens of thousands every year.  This church is a product of that vision and is working to see it expanded in the short time that remains before Jesus' return.  God has given us a vision for the day we live in.  Our message is simple, yet it is the cornerstone of all truth.  Jesus Christ is the only hope for man's salvation and that is true with every person in every nation on the globe.  In a world full of empty dreams and false promises is a truth which grows stronger every year, and that is Jesus Christ and Him crucified!
